The purpose of this theoretical research study is to examine the intersections between learner agency theory and hip hop pedagogy. We posit an integrated theoretical approach to conceptualizing learner agency and its application within hip hop pedagogy as an example of learner agency “in action.” We used Bandura’s social cognitive theory and cultural-historical activity theory to frame our analysis. Our method of inquiry includes 4 phases of systematic review. Findings show that learner agency theory is an interdisciplinary construct that can be heavily applied within the Hip Hop Studies discipline.
